traffic jam
US /ˈtræf.ɪk ˌdʒæm/
UK /ˈtræf.ɪk ˌdʒæm/

Noun
1.
a long line of vehicles on a road that cannot move or can only move very slowly
Example:
•
I was stuck in a huge traffic jam for an hour.
•
The accident caused a massive traffic jam on the highway.
